In recent years, the popularity of home daycare services is increasing. With an increase of and more parents pursuing flexible and inexpensive childcare options, residence daycare providers became a well known choice for many people. However, as with any types of childcare arrangement, you can find both positives and negatives to consider regarding home daycare.

class=One of the most significant great things about house daycare is the personalized care and attention that kids obtain. Unlike larger daycare centers, residence daycare providers typically have smaller groups of children to look after, permitting them to give each young one much more individualized interest. This is especially beneficial for children who might need extra support or have special requirements. Also, house daycare providers usually have even more mobility inside their schedules, allowing them to accommodate the needs of working moms and dads who may have non-traditional work hours.

Another advantage of house Daycare Near Me By State may be the home-like environment that children are able to experience. In a property daycare environment, kiddies are able to play and discover in a cushty and familiar environment, which can help them feel more secure and comfortable. This could be specifically beneficial for youngsters whom may have trouble with separation anxiety whenever being remaining in a bigger, much more institutionalized daycare setting.

Residence daycare providers additionally usually have more mobility when it comes to curriculum and activities. In a property daycare setting, providers have the freedom to tailor their programs into specific requirements and passions for the kids in their care. This will allow for more innovative and individualized discovering experiences, which are often good for children of most ages.

Despite these benefits, there are some drawbacks to consider when it comes to house daycare. One of the main problems that moms and dads may have may be the lack of supervision and legislation in house daycare facilities. Unlike bigger daycare facilities, which are generally subject to strict certification demands and laws, residence daycare providers might not be held into the same requirements. This might boost issues towards high quality and safety of treatment that young ones obtain during these options.

Another prospective disadvantage of residence daycare is the restricted socialization possibilities that kiddies may have. In property daycare environment, kiddies are typically just reaching a small selection of colleagues, which might perhaps not give them exactly the same amount of socialization and exposure to diverse experiences they would get in a bigger daycare center. This could be a concern for parents just who value socialization and peer conversation as essential the different parts of their child's development.

Additionally, residence daycare providers may deal with challenges about balancing their particular caregiving responsibilities with regards to individual resides. Numerous house daycare providers are self-employed and will struggle to get a hold of a work-life balance, particularly when they have been looking after children in their own personal domiciles. This might trigger burnout and anxiety, which can fundamentally influence the quality of treatment that kids receive.

Overall, residence daycare are a fantastic selection for households trying to find versatile and individualized childcare choices. However, it is very important for parents to carefully consider the positives and negatives of home daycare before carefully deciding. By evaluating the professionals and cons of home daycare and doing comprehensive study on potential providers, parents can ensure that these are typically choosing the best childcare choice for kids.

Finally, home daycare may be a valuable and enriching experience for kids, offering them with personalized care, a home-like environment, and versatile programming. But parents should be aware of the possibility drawbacks, such as for instance restricted oversight and socialization opportunities, and do something to make sure that they've been choosing a reputable and top-notch residence daycare supplier. With consideration and analysis, residence daycare is an optimistic and enjoyable childcare choice for many households.
